Juan Sánchez de Castro was a Spanish painter active in Seville from 1478 to 1502. His late Gothic and Hispano-Flemish style differs greatly from that of an homonymous artist, Juan Sánchez de San Román, also active in Seville during the same period. [1]
His works or those of his circle can be found in the Seville Cathedral, the Museum of Fine Arts of Seville and the Museu Nacional d'Art de Catalunya. [2]
